How they compare

Barbados currently reports 17.8% against 16.4% in El Salvador, a difference of 1.4%.

That makes Barbados's figure about 1.1 times El Salvador's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 11 shared years of data; in 2014 it was El Salvador ahead.

Barbados ranks 32nd and El Salvador ranks 35th of 177 countries.

El Salvador has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.

Children out of school are the percentage of primary-school-age children who are not enrolled in primary or secondary school. Children in the official primary age group that are in preprimary education should be considered out of school.
